Sven-Erik Seaholm

sven erik seaholmLead vocalist and songwriter Sven-Erik Seaholm is a familiar name to fans of the San Diego music scene, as he is also a well-respected record producer. In 2003 & 2005, he received special San Diego Music Awards for Producer of the Year. 2003 also saw the release of his critically acclaimed solo album Upload, and he spent much of 2004 as a member of the popular vocal band The Gandhi Method. David Ybarra

david ybarraBassist David Ybarra is no stranger either, having held down the bottom end for Playground Slap, The Cloud Merchants and 44 Double D, as well as producing clients like Meghan LaRoque for his production company, The Modern Bakery. Charlie Loach

charlie loachGuitarist Charlie Loach is also a local music veteran whose fiery riffs and passionate soloing have been lighting up stages and studios throughout Southern California. His background in both blues and country music bring a unique twist to The Wild Truth's power pop recipe.

Bill Ray

Bill Ray seems to have been born with drumsticks in his hands because he can't remember not playing. His earliest memories are banging on his father's drumset and watching him play. A chip off the old block, Bill was quick to emulate what he saw and has been at it ever since. The passion set afire in his early years has taken him around the world as a drummer, teacher and author.

Never satisfied with the status quo, musically or otherwise, Bill strives to be different in his approach to playing music. This difference comes through not only in his playing but in "Time, Space, & Rhythm," Bill's acclaimed drumming lesson book. A frequent player at Jazz and Blues festivals throughout Europe and Japan, Bill is as comfortable in front of a stadium full of fans as he is jamming with friends in local jazz/funk bands in a coffee shop or in a studio session.

Bill's musical influences and interests are very wide. Most recently, he's become a great fan of the rich textures and rhythms of Eastern European choral music. Of course, Bill will be quick to point out his interests in artists like Trilok Gurtu and Jonas Hellborg as well as to pay homage to a long list of musical inspirations.
